The healthcare field has witnessed a radical transformation in recent years due to the integration of digital technologies and artificial intelligence into academic and clinical environments. Among the medical fields impacted by AI is performance assessment, where AI is playing an increasingly important role in accurately and rapidly measuring and evaluating nursing skills. This positively impacts the quality of training and educational outcomes, which are fundamental pillars of healthcare.
The systems used in assessment are computer-based systems capable of analyzing diverse data such as audio, text, videos, and clinical simulations to provide automated and accurate assessments of student or trainee nurse performance. These models rely on technologies including deep learning, natural language processing (NLP), and computer vision. Some of these applications include:
Virtual simulation applications, which analyze student performance while handling virtual clinical scenarios, recording responses, dosage errors, and procedure timing.
Applications for analyzing communication with patients, which analyze body language, tone of voice, terminology, and measure rapport, emotional support, and adherence to professional ethics. Applications for assessing procedural skills, such as tracking movement during tasks like administering injections or inserting catheters, allow for comparison of performance against standard benchmarks.
Applications for analyzing student learning records identify individual student weaknesses and propose customized learning plans.
Applications for monitoring staff professional development use the results of intelligent assessments to determine ongoing training needs. All these applications, and more, offer educational and practical benefits, including greater accuracy and objectivity in assessment, time and effort savings, immediate feedback, personalized training, and improved quality of nursing staff output, directly impacting patient safety and the efficiency of care provided.
